Model Ekonomi Pengalaman: Memahami Perilaku Konsumen dan Layanan Konten Berbayar

Abstract: Dalam penulisan ini akan mendeskripsikan secara kualitatif mengenai model kepuasan individu dalam perspektif ekonomis dengan menggunakan pendekatan konsep ekonomi pengalaman dan ekonomi perilaku secara kualitatif. Metode penelitian yang digunakan adalah konsep teoritisasi data (grounded theory approach) dan melakukan pengembangan terhadap konsep pengkodean berbuka, pengkodean berporos dan pengkodean berpilih untuk memberikan pendekatan kualitatif yang maksimal dalam memahami ekonomi pengalaman. “…The data used is secondary data, this data has characteristics obtained from other sources so that researchers can directly process data, this is different from primary data which must be taken independently by researchers by paying attention to research objects and subjects (Firmansyah & Maulana, 2021). Qualitative research can use the stages in thematic analysis as a start in identifying problems and phenomena (Firmansyah, 2020;Kiger & Varpio, 2020). The framework most used for conducting thematic analysis involves a six-step process: familiarizing yourself with the data, generating initial code, searching for themes, reviewing themes, defining and naming themes, and generating reports (Kiger & Varpio, 2020).…”

“…According to David L. Loudon and Albert J. Della Bitta: "Consumer behavior can be defined as a decision-making process and individual activities physically involved in the process of evaluating, obtaining, using or being able to use goods and services (Firmansyah, 2018). Schiffman and Kanuk (1994) define the term consumer behavior as the behavior shown by consumers in searching for, buying, using, evaluating, and spending on products and services that they expect will satisfy their needs (Sumarwan, 2003).…”
